PRC-Sindh distributed 400 hygiene kits in Hyderabad 

Karachi, November 13, 2021 (PPI-OT):The Sindh branch of Pakistan Red Crescent distributed 400 hygiene kits to the most vulnerable communities affected by COVID-19 in Hyderabad. The distribution of hygiene kits as part of the PRC-ECHO WASH-COVID Response Program in collaboration with IFRC.

While distributing the hygiene kits, Deputy Commissioner of Hyderabad and President of Red Crescent District Branch Hyderabad Fuad Ghaffar Soomro praised the selection process of the beneficiaries. He also appreciated the efforts of the Red Crescent to provide relief to the vulnerable communities in every disaster and emergency situation.

The distribution ceremony was attended by Dr. Allauddin Shah Convener Red Crescent General Hospital Hyderabad (RCGHH), Dr. Humayoun Anjum Rana MS, RCGHH, Abdul Haq Sheikh, Convener HR Committee Hyderabad Red Crescent, Marvi Awan, PRCS Coordinator for Hyderabad and Zainul Arfeen Emergency Response Officer, PRC-Sindh. Beneficiaries expressed their gratitude for receiving hygiene kits and lauded the Pakistan Red Crescent’s initiatives in Hyderabad.
